// ----------------------------------------------
// HERE COMES THE QUITE IMPORTANT SYNC ALGORITHM!
//
// 1. Reduce all server changes (not client changes) that have occurred after given
// baseRevision (our changes) to a set (key/value object where key is the combination of table/primaryKey)
// 2. Check all client changes against reduced server
// changes to detect conflict. Resolve conflicts:
// If server created an object with same key as client creates, updates or deletes: Always discard client change.
// If server deleted an object with same key as client creates, updates or deletes: Always discard client change.
// If server updated an object with same key as client updates:
// Apply all properties the client updates unless they conflict with server updates
// If server updated an object with same key as client creates:
// Apply the client create but apply the server update on top
// If server updated an object with same key as client deletes: Let client win. Deletes always wins over Updates.
//
// 3. After resolving conflicts, apply client changes into server database.
// 4. Send an ack to the client that we have persisted its changes
// ----------------------------------------------
